Deportation proceedings can be initiated for a variety of reasons, often stemming from intricate immigration laws and regulations.
Common grounds for deportation include, but are not limited to:
Visa Violations: Overstaying a visa, violating the terms of a non-immigrant visa, or engaging in unauthorized employment.
Criminal Convictions: Certain criminal offenses, even seemingly minor ones, can lead to serious immigration consequences, including mandatory detention and deportation. This includes crimes involving moral turpitude, aggravated felonies, and drug offenses.
Immigration Fraud: Misrepresentation or fraud committed during the visa application process or while attempting to gain immigration benefits.
Unlawful Entry: Entering the US without inspection or proper authorization.
Failure to Adjust Status: Not adhering to the requirements for adjusting immigration status.
